How they compare

Jordan currently reports 25.9% against 25.4% in Albania, a difference of 0.5%.

The two have swapped places 8 times across 20 shared years of data; in 1995 it was Jordan ahead.

Albania ranks 82nd and Jordan ranks 81st of 157 countries.

Jordan has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ade Albania Jordan Difference Ahead
1990s 24.2% 28.0% 3.8% Jordan
2000s 22.7% 30.0% 7.3% Jordan
2010s 23.5% 24.4% 0.9% Jordan
2020s 25.4% 26.0% 0.6% Jordan

Averages of every year both report within each decade.

Expense is a decrease in net worth resulting from a transaction. This indicator is expressed as a percentage of Gross Domestic Product (GDP) which is the total income earned through the production of goods and services in an economic territory during an accounting period.
